About This Topic

Effective communication is the study of how individuals, groups, and organizations exchange information clearly and purposefully. It appears across numerous disciplines, including business, education, healthcare, counseling, and public relations, making it one of the most broadly assigned topics in communications coursework. Students are drawn to it because communication underpins nearly every professional and interpersonal context, from team leadership and organizational management to early childhood education and patient care. Its academic interest lies in how seemingly simple exchanges can succeed or fail depending on structure, medium, audience awareness, and interpersonal skill.

A strong essay on effective communication should establish a clear, specific thesis rather than simply asserting that communication matters. The most persuasive papers ground their arguments in concrete contexts — a particular profession, relationship type, or organizational structure — and use identifiable barriers and strategies as evidence. A common pitfall is staying too abstract; broad claims about the importance of clarity carry little weight without specific examples of what breaks down when communication fails and what measurably improves when it succeeds.
